Output ef9923de726202359d0a99bc9e2859ca9bc7a47538651983f5e4bbc5ce9eba32:15
- value
- 965870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1237fc35f1580242eccd8cf11e159e4101344897 OP_EQUAL
- address
- 33MM9v7E4NmaM4Z2ZZWMgVVf3whnmeeusv
- transaction
- ef9923de726202359d0a99bc9e2859ca9bc7a47538651983f5e4bbc5ce9eba32
- confirmations
- 419254
- spent
- true